Kate Hudson says it was 'right thing' to end relationships with sons' fathers: 'I don’t feel the failure'

Kate Hudson reflected this week on her exes, saying she knew that it was the "right thing" to end her relationships with her sons' fathers.  "I’m impulsive," Hudson told Bruce Bozzi on the "Table for Two" podcast Tuesday. "I jump right in. I love love." But the "Glass Onion" actress said "as you get older, you kind of get to that place where … you learn." She said that despite the "depth in which I felt like I had failed relationships and family, with my partners throughout those years" she knew it was the "right thing to not be in those relationships" with Chris Robinson, who is 19-year-old Ryder’s father, and Matt Bellamy, who is 11-year-old Bingham’s father.

Kate Hudson says she didn't pursue a music career because of 'daddy issues' with estranged father Bill Hudson

Kate Hudson opened up about why she did not initially pursue a career in music during a Tuesday appearance on the podcast "Table for Two with Bruce Bozzi." The 43-year-old actress, who is currently working on her debut album, shared that her strained relationship with her biological father, singer Bill Hudson, led her to reject making music for many years. "Earlier on in my career, I thought I would definitely do music, but then 'Almost Famous' happened," Hudson said, referring to her Oscar-nominated breakthrough role as groupie Penny Lane in Cameron Crowe's 2000 film.

Kate Hudson Says She Felt Like She'd Failed Following Split From Chris Robinson & Matt Bellamy

Kate Hudson is opening up about some of her past romances, break-ups, and what she gleaned emotionally from the challenging experiences.Hudson recently sat down for a chat on the podcast , and she reflected on her past «failed» relationships — specifically with ex-husband Chris Robinson and ex-fiancé Matt Bellamy.According to Hudson, the break-ups were painful and difficult, but ultimately she knew they were necessary.«As hard as the decisions were in my life, and the depth in which I felt like I had failed relationships and family, with my partners throughout those years — whether it be Chris or Matt — I knew it was the right thing to not be in those relationships,» Hudson explained. «I knew that we'd all be happier.»«It's a choice; you either stay in them, wondering what your life would have been like if you would have left them or [you] choose to leave,» she continued.Hudson shares a 19-year-old son, Ryder, with Robinson, and an 11-year-old son, Bingham, with Bellamy.

Kate Hudson on role she lost to Nicole Kidman: ‘They went way older’

Kate Hudson isn’t holding a grudge over Nicole Kidman — but she might be throwing shade.The “Glass Onion” star, 43, looked back at her career during her recent appearance on the podcast “You’re Doing Fine … Just Keep Going” about how she wished she had scored the lead role in the 2001 film “Moulin Rouge” — instead of Nicole Kidman, 55.Hudson revealed she was passed over to play the character Satine in the Baz Luhrmann musical film when she was 22 and Kidman was 34.“One of my favorite auditions I ever did was with Baz Luhrmann … he was so inspiring and so much fun,” she said.Hudson recalled her feelings about the audition at the time: “Even if I don’t get this part — which I didn’t because they went way older … what a great experience that was to do a work session with Baz Luhrmann.”The ingenue in 2000’s “Almost Famous” confessed that she “really wanted that part” and was “bummed out” when she lost it to Kidman.Hudson alleged that the Australian starlet had a professional working relationship with Luhrmann, who also hails from Australia, that helped elevate her chances of landing the lead role.She added that she underwent a “hardcore auditioning process” for the film and further alleged that “it was written at the time for a young … 19-year-old girl.” “And so, of course, it was like, ‘I guess Nicole Kidman’s doing it,’” Hudson sighed on the podcast episode. “Of course, totally got it, because it’s Nicole.
